Modern Technological Progress in Diamond Production
Innovations in technology have revolutionized the method of diamond creation, making it increasingly efficient and available than ever before. Approaches such as High Pressure High Temperature (HPHT) and Chemical Vapor Deposition (CVD) have appeared as dominant methods for creating synthetic diamonds. HPHT replicates the natural conditions under which diamonds form, while CVD enables the growth of diamonds from a gas phase, enabling greater control over quality and size. These innovations have substantially reduced production costs and time, helping manufacturers to create diamonds that are nearly indistinguishable from their mined counterparts. As a result, the quality of synthetic diamonds has advanced, drawing consumers pursuing both affordability and sustainability without diminishing on aesthetic appeal.
The Ecological Effects of Laboratory-Grown Gemstones
The advent of synthetic diamonds has not only transformed the jewelry market but also raised important questions about their environmental impact. Unlike traditional diamond mining, which often leads to significant ecological disruption, lab-created gems require significantly fewer natural resources. The process of creating synthetic diamonds typically uses less water and emits fewer greenhouse gases. Additionally, there is no risk of habitat destruction or pollution connected to mining operations. However, the energy consumption of production facilities must be evaluated, as it can vary widely depending on the source of energy used. All things considered, lab-created diamonds present a more sustainable alternative, appealing to environmentally conscious consumers seeking to reduce their ecological footprint while enjoying the beauty of fine jewelry.

How Does the Quality of Synthetic Diamonds Compare to Natural Diamonds?
Lab-grown diamonds frequently display quality comparable to natural diamonds, possessing identical physical and chemical properties. Each type can attain similar clarity, cut, and color, although lab-created diamonds generally provide a more budget-friendly price point without compromising quality.
Do Certain Brands Specialize in High-Quality Synthetic Diamonds?
Several brands, including Brilliant Earth, MiaDonna, and Clean Origin, are acknowledged for their premium synthetic diamonds. These organizations focus on ethical sourcing, excellent craftsmanship, and competitive pricing, catering to consumers seeking alternatives to traditional natural diamonds.
What Certifications Can Synthetic Diamonds Receive?
Lab-created diamonds may be certified by multiple organizations, such as the Gemological Institute of America (GIA), International Gemological Institute (IGI), and the Gem Certification and Assurance Lab (GCAL), providing quality and authenticity for consumers.
Can Synthetic Diamonds Be Resized or Repaired Like Natural Diamonds?
Man-made diamonds can be resized or repaired just like natural diamonds, as they have the same chemical and physical properties. Jewelers usually use standard techniques for both types, maintaining both quality and structural integrity during the work.
How Can Synthetic Diamonds Impact Traditional Diamond Mining Communities?
Synthetic diamonds can negatively impact traditional diamond mining communities by decreasing demand for mined diamonds, possibly leading to employment reduction and economic downturn in these areas. Conversely, they may also promote diversification and alternative economic possibilities.
